Thailand Flag Flag Information five horizontal bands of red (top), white, blue (double width), white, and red the red color symbolizes the nation and the blood of life, white represents religion and the purity of Buddhism, and blue stands for the monarchy note: similar to the flag of Costa Rica but with the blue and red colors reversed
